Zaniya Booker Obituary, Death – Zaniya Booker, a 17-year-old girl from Milwaukee, was tragically killed in a shooting on Wednesday, January 22. The Milwaukee County Medical Examiner’s Office officially identified her on Thursday afternoon.

The incident occurred around 4:45 p.m. at a residence located on the 4400 block of North 28th Street. Milwaukee Police are actively investigating the circumstances surrounding the shooting and are currently searching for a suspect. Authorities have not yet provided details about what led to the incident.

Attempts by the Journal Sentinel to contact Booker’s family for comment were unsuccessful as of Thursday. Police are urging anyone with information about the shooting to come forward by contacting Milwaukee Police at 414-935-7360. Those who wish to remain anonymous can reach out to Crime Stoppers at 414-224-TIPS or use the P3 Tips App.

This tragic loss marks the fourth homicide reported in Milwaukee in 2025, according to police department data, and that number has since risen to five. Booker is the first individual under 18 to fall victim to violence in the city this year.
